Fiji Labour Party lawyer says branch suspension of MP a political gimmick

6:46 am on 11 July 2006

The Fiji Labour Party lawyer, Anand Singh, says the suspension of cabinet minister Krishna Datt by his Nasinu constituency branch last week was a political gimmick engineered by one man.

Fijilive quotes Anand Singh as saying the party's constitution was not properly followed when 19 members of the Nasinu Branch signed a petition suspending Mr Datt.

Mr Singh says Mr Datt was denied natural justice because the members could not suspend Mr Datt without proper procedures being followed.

Mr Datt is among five senior Labour Party members targetted by the Labour Party leader, Mahendra Chaudhry, for disciplinary action and possible expulsion for questioning his leadership style after a dispute about his senate appointments.

The Labour Party's Nasinu Branch has withdrawn Mr Datt's suspension after most members revolted against it and has reinstated him.

Mr Datt has confirmed receiving a letter reinstating him.
